Быстрое создание нумерации строк или последовательности дат начинается с активации маркера заполнения в правом нижнем углу ячейки. Этот инструмент позволяет генерировать ряды чисел, даты и пользовательские списки без ручного ввода каждого значения, что критически важно при работе с большими массивами данных. Если стандартный перетаскивание копирует значение вместо создания последовательности, необходимо изменить настройки автозаполнения или использовать специальные клавиши-модификаторы для корректного выполнения задачи.
В большинстве случаев пользователи хотят получить строго возрастающий ряд, где каждое следующее число больше предыдущего на единицу или заданный шаг. Стандартное поведение программы может варьироваться в зависимости от того, выделена ли одна ячейка или диапазон из двух и более элементов. Понимание логики работы умного маркера позволяет мгновенно переключаться между режимом копирования и режимом продолжения ряда, экономя время на рутинных операциях.
Для начала работы достаточно ввести начальные значения в ячейки, выделить их и потянуть за угол выделения вниз или вправо. Система автоматически распознает закономерность и продолжит её, будь то простые числа 1, 2, 3 или более сложные арифметические прогрессии. В случае сбоя или unexpected поведения интерфейса, всегда можно воспользоваться контекстным меню или диалоговым окном для принудительного задания параметров заполнения.
Настройка параметров автозаполнения в Excel
Прежде чем приступать к массовому созданию списков, стоит убедиться, что в настройках программы активирована соответствующая функция. Иногда маркер заполнения может быть отключен или работать некорректно из-за изменений в глобальных параметрах приложения. Проверка этих настроек занимает всего минуту, но избавляет от множества проблем в будущем.
Для доступа к конфигурации перейдите в меню Файл и выберите пункт Параметры. В открывшемся окне найдите раздел Дополнительно и прокрутите список до блока Параметры правки. Здесь должна стоять галочка напротив пункта «Разрешить перетаскивание ячеек». Если флажок снят, инструмент работать не будет, и вам придется каждый раз использовать копирование и вставку вручную.
Также в этом разделе можно настроить поведение маркера при выделении диапазона. Опция Отображать параметры автозаполнения позволяет видеть всплывающее меню сразу после завершения перетаскивания, где можно быстро выбрать тип заполнения: копировать ячейки, заполнить только форматом или заполнить без формата. Отключение этой опции ускоряет работу опытных пользователей, но новичкам лучше оставить её включенной для контроля процесса.
⚠️ Внимание: Если после включения перетаскивания маркер все равно не появляется, проверьте, не отключен ли он в надстройках или не блокируется ли макросами, запущенными в фоновом режиме.
Изменение параметров повлияет на то, как работает автозаполнение цифр во всех ваших проектах. После внесения изменений нажмите ОК, чтобы сохранить конфигурацию и вернуться к таблице.
Создание простой нумерации и последовательностей
Самый распространенный сценарий использования — создание сквозной нумерации строк. Для этого введите число 1 в первую ячейку, а число 2 во вторую. Выделите обе ячейки, наведите курсор на правый нижний угол выделения, пока он не превратится в черный крестик, и потяните вниз.
Excel распознает шаг последовательности (в данном случае +1) и продолжит ряд: 3, 4, 5 и так далее. Если выделить только одну ячейку с цифрой 1 и потянуть, программа по умолчанию скопирует единицу. Чтобы заставить её создать последовательность, удерживайте клавишу Ctrl во время перетаскивания. Курсор изменится, добавится маленький плюсик, сигнализирующий о режиме продолжения ряда.
- 🔢 Выделение двух ячеек с числами создает арифметическую прогрессию с шагом, равным разнице между ними.
- 📅 Выделение дат позволяет автоматически заполнять дни недели, месяцы или годы с шагом в один день.
- 🔄 Зажатая клавиша
Ctrlинвертирует стандартное поведение: копирует вместо продолжения ряда или наоборот.
Если вам нужно заполнить ряд с шагом, отличным от единицы, например, 2, 4, 6, введите первые два числа (2 и 4), выделите их и протяните. Программа сама вычислит разницу и применит её к остальным ячейкам. Это работает для любых числовых значений, включая отрицательные числа и десятичные дроби.
☑️ Проверка перед заполнением
Использование меню «Прогрессия» для сложных рядов
Когда требуется заполнить тысячи строк или создать сложную геометрическую прогрессию, ручное перетаскивание становится неэффективным. В таких случаях лучше воспользоваться встроенным инструментом Прогрессия, который находится на вкладке Главная в группе Редактирование. Нажмите кнопку Заполнить и выберите Прогрессия.
В открывшемся диалоговом окне можно детально настроить параметры заполнения. Вы можете выбрать расположение: по строкам или по столбцам. Тип прогрессии позволяет переключаться между арифметической (линейный рост), геометрической (экспоненциальный рост), датами и автозаполнением. Здесь же задается шаг и предельное значение, до которого нужно вести заполнение.
| Параметр | Описание | Пример значения |
|---|---|---|
| Расположение | Направление заполнения | По столбцам |
| Тип | Логика роста чисел | Арифметическая |
| Шаг | Величина приращения | 5 |
| Предельное значение | Максимальное число в ряду | 1000 |
Использование этого метода гарантирует высокую точность и скорость, особенно когда нужно заполнить диапазон до конкретного числа, например, до 10 000. Вам не нужно визуально контролировать процесс, система сама остановится, когда достигнет заданного предела. Это исключает человеческий фактор и ошибки при подсчете количества ячеек.
⚠️ Внимание: При выборе геометрической прогрессии убедитесь, что шаг не равен нулю, иначе все значения после первой ячейки станут нулевыми, что может нарушить расчеты.
Автозаполнение дат и дней недели
Работа с временными интервалами имеет свои особенности, так как даты в Excel являются числами, отформатированныыми специальным образом. При автозаполнении дат программа по умолчанию увеличивает значение на один день. Однако, если вы выделите ячейку с датой, которая попадает на понедельник, и потянете за маркер, Excel может предложить продолжить ряд днями недели, пропуская выходные.
Для управления этим процессом используйте контекстное меню, которое появляется после перетаскивания (кнопка «Параметры автозаполнения»). В нем доступны опции: «Заполнить по дням», «Заполнить по рабочим дням», «Заполнить по месяцам» и «Заполнить по годам». Выбор опции «Заполнить по рабочим дням» автоматически пропустит субботу и воскресенье, что удобно для составления графиков работы.
Если ввести в ячейку текст «Январь» или «Понедельник» и потянуть за угол, Excel продолжит список месяцами или днями недели. Это работает благодаря встроенным пользовательскими списками. Вы можете создавать свои собственные списки через Файл -> Параметры -> Дополнительно -> Изменить списки, добавив туда, например, список фамилий сотрудников или названия филиалов.
- 📅 Ввод даты и перетаскивание с правой кнопкой мыши сразу открывает меню выбора типа заполнения.
- 🗓️ Формат даты (ДД.ММ.ГГГГ или ДД-ММ-ГГ) сохраняется при автозаполнении, если не выбрано иное.
- 🔄 Комбинация
Ctrl+ перетаскивание даты копирует ячейку, а не меняет дату.
Секретные коды дней недели
В Excel можно использовать сокращения. Введите"Пн" и протяните — получите"Пн, Вт, Ср..". Введите"Янв" — получите"Янв, Фев, Мар..". Программа распознает стандартные сокращения месяцев и дней на языке интерфейса.>
Применение формул для генерации чисел
Для динамического заполнения, которое будет меняться при удалении строк или изменении структуры таблицы, лучше использовать формулы. Функция СТРОКА (или ROW в английской версии) возвращает номер строки, в которой находится ячейка. Записав формулу =СТРОКА(A1) и протянув её вниз, вы получите последовательность 1, 2, 3 и т.д.
Преимущество такого подхода в том, что нумерация не собьется, если вы отсортируете таблицу или удалите одну из строк посередине. Формула автоматически пересчитает значения. Для создания нумерации с шагом, отличным от 1, или с заданным стартом, используйте математические операции. Например, =(СТРОКА(A1)-1)*5+10 создаст ряд 10, 15, 20, 25..
Еще одна мощная функция — ПОСЛЕДОВАТЕЛЬНОСТЬ (SEQUENCE), доступная в новых версиях Excel. Она позволяет одним формулой заполнить целый диапазон. Синтаксис: =ПОСЛЕДОВАТЕЛЬНОСТЬ(число_строк; число_столбцов; начало; шаг). Введя =ПОСЛЕДОВАТЕЛЬНОСТЬ(100;1;1;1) в одну ячейку, вы мгновенно получите список из 100 чисел.
⚠️ Внимание: Формулы с функцией СТРОКА могут дать сбой, если вы вставите строки выше диапазона нумерации, так как абсолютные ссылки могут сместиться. Используйте относительные ссылки или именованные диапазоны для стабильности.
Устранение и работа с форматами
Часто пользователи сталкиваются с ситуацией, когда вместо чисел получаются копии одной и той же цифры. Это происходит, если не активирован режим продолжения ряда. Проверьте, появляется ли всплывающая подсказка с номером заполняемой строки при перетаскивании. Если вместо чисел появляются хештеги (#####), просто расширьте столбец.
Еще одна проблема — изменение формата. При автозаполнении Excel может применить формат первой ячейки ко всему диапазону. Если вы заполняете числа, а получаете даты (или наоборот), проверьте формат ячеек через Ctrl+1. Иногда помогает очистка формата перед началом заполнения.
Если автозаполнение обрывается раньше времени, возможно, в соседнем столбце есть пустые ячейки или данные, которые Excel пытается использовать как ограничитель. В таких случаях лучше выделять целевой диапазон заранее или использовать метод двойного клика по маркеру заполнения, который работает только при наличии смежных данных.
- 🛑 Если ряд не строится, убедитесь, что в ячейках нет скрытых пробелов или апострофов перед числами.
- 🔍 Двойной клик по маркеру заполняет столбец до конца соседнего заполненного столбца.
- 🧹 Очистка форматов через меню «Главная» -> «Очистить» -> «Очистить форматы» помогает сбросить ошибки отображения.
Почему Excel копирует число вместо увеличения?
Это стандартное поведение при выделении одной ячейки. Чтобы увеличить число, нужно выделить две ячейки с заданным шагом или удерживать клавишу Ctrl при перетаскивании одной ячейки.
Как сделать нумерацию только для видимых строк?
Автозаполнение работает и для скрытых строк. Чтобы пронумеровать только видимые, используйте формулу с функциями ПОДЫТОГИТЬ или АГРЕГАТ, либо выделите видимые ячейки через F5 -> Выделить только видимые ячейки и введите формулу с Ctrl+Enter.
Можно ли автозаполнять случайные числа?
Да, используйте функцию СЛЧИС (RAND) или СЛУЧМЕЖДУ (RANDBETWEEN). Однако при протягивании они будут пересчитываться. Для фиксации используйте копирование и вставку значений.
Что делать, если маркер заполнения не работает?
Проверьте настройки в Параметрах Excel (раздел Дополнительно). Убедитесь, что галочка «Разрешить перетаскивание ячеек» установлена. Также проверьте, не отключены ли макросы, блокирующие это действие.
Как изменить шаг автозаполнения на лету?
После заполнения ряда нажмите на появившуюся кнопку «Параметры автозаполнения» и выберите «Заполнить только форматом» или используйте меню «Прогрессия» для точной настройки шага.